GRAPPIN v. STATE

No. 63450.

450 So.2d 480 (1984)

Kent Edward GRAPPIN, Petitioner, v. STATE of Florida, Respondent.

Supreme Court of Florida.

May 10, 1984.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Jerry Hill, Public Defender, and Allyn Giambalvo, Asst. Public Defender, Clearwater, for petitioner.

Jim Smith, Atty. Gen., Tallahassee, and Robert J. Krauss, Asst. Atty. Gen., Tampa, for respondent.


OVERTON, Justice.

This is a petition to review a decision of the Second District Court of Appeal reported as State v. Grappin, 427 So.2d 760 (Fla. 2d DCA 1983), in which the district court held that the unlawful taking of two or more firearms during the same criminal episode is subject to separate prosecution and punishment under the theft statute as to each firearm taken.
